Assessments

Online assessments of mental health can be a great tool to determine if you are suffering from a mental illness and to discover the treatment options available. These tools are simple to use and will help you determine if you have a treatable mental disorder such as depression or anxiety. These tests will ask you about your symptoms and how they affect you and your family history. The truthfulness of your answers is vital. The more precise you are, the higher your chances of receiving an accurate diagnosis. You must be prepared to discuss any medication you are currently taking or have taken previously. Certain drugs may influence your mood or thoughts, so it is important to give your doctor the complete picture of your medical condition.

A comprehensive online psychological assessment can be conducted within a matter of minutes. It's a great alternative for traditional psychological assessments in person which can be expensive and time-consuming. These assessment tools online can be used to test for anxiety, depression and other disorders. They can help you make an informed decision on the best treatment option for your specific situation.

These assessments also allow therapists to monitor their clients' progress and monitor their well-being. These assessments are extremely valuable for their practice and can assist them in developing targeted interventions and encourage client engagement. The digital format of these assessments also allows for standard data collection, which helps reduce errors and increase efficiency. Furthermore, these assessments can integrate with existing systems, like electronic health record (EHR) systems and practice management software.

When selecting an online mental assessment tool, make sure you choose one that has been rigorously tested and validated. These procedures involve comparing the results of the tool with established clinical standards and validated measures. This will ensure that the tool is accurate in measuring what it claims to measure and is devoid of bias. Make sure the tool is accessible across different platforms and devices like tablets, smartphones and computers, as well as other mobile devices.

Despite the growing popularity of these tests there are some limitations. For example, they may not accurately diagnose the signs of mental illness or predict when a person will seek help. They also don't necessarily reflect the experiences of all people. Finally, there is the risk of misdiagnosis and over-treatment.

Reports

Psychiatric assessment tools are used by doctors to detect signs of mental health disorders and identify their underlying etiologies. These tools include questionnaires and interview questions that assess the severity, frequency, and length of symptoms. These tools are based upon a particular classification system, and they only cover the most prevalent symptoms. This can result in inconsistent results in diagnosis and hinder research into the underlying etiology of psychiatric disorders.

The recent introduction of online assessment tools has changed the landscape of the psychiatric camhs neurodevelopmental assessment and diagnosis. These instruments are designed to collect data and offer a report of the results of the user within a matter of minutes. They can also connect the user to a local, qualified treatment facility. They also permit the patient to track their progress over time, and assist in monitoring the changes in symptoms.

Self-assessments online can be a useful tool to spot certain signs. However, they can not replace a thorough assessment from a mental health specialist. They could even result in a false diagnosis because the results of these assessments can be misleading if not taken into consideration with other factors, including the patient's background and life events.

Furthermore it is possible that the use of different assessment tools by different medical professionals can cause inconsistent diagnosis, as these tools typically focus on certain symptoms and do NOT necessarily cover all aspects of a disorder's presentation. This is particularly true when it comes to unusual mental health assessment court ordered illness symptoms, which are more prevalent in older patients and often have symptoms that overlap with other disorders.

Fortunately technology is helping reduce the barriers to mental health care and is bringing it to more people than ever before. Digital assessment tools are expanding rapidly as more clinicians realize the benefits of these cutting-edge and powerful tools to improve access to psychiatric care for patients. Digital tools are also more convenient, cost-effective, and offer greater data collection capacity. They also cut down on the time required for clinical assessment mental health assessments.

The most commonly used treatments for mental illness are psychotherapy and mental medications. These treatments can be used either in conjunction or individually. Psychotherapy, also known as talk therapy, aids people with a range of problems, including anxiety and depression. These treatments could be individualized, meaning that the person is the only one in the room with a therapist or they can be group therapy. Group therapy involves a small group of patients who meet regularly to discuss their concerns. It can be very helpful to know that others have similar problems and listen to their stories.

Other forms of treatment include interpersonal psychotherapy, family psychotherapy, cognitive behavior therapy, and many more. CBT and IPT aid people in learning to alter their thinking patterns, behavior, and relationships. They can help people learn how they can manage stress and develop the ability to cope. Family therapy is a great way to work with loved ones to address problems and establish healthy relationships.

Some people have such severe mental disorders that they require treatment in a residential treatment center or hospital mental health assessment. This kind of treatment is usually brief and designed to stabilize the patient. This may be a viable option for those who are suicidal, or at risk of causing harm to themselves.

A thorough psychiatric examination typically includes a physical examination as well as an interview with the patient and family members, as well as a discussion of their symptoms. The evaluation also includes a review the patient's medical background and medications. It is crucial to answer all questions honestly and accurately in order to ensure the correct diagnosis is made. While a psychiatrist is able to make a diagnosis from the symptoms on their own, they need to examine other factors as well, such as lifestyle and environment.

Multiple studies have shown online interventions can be effective in treating mental state assesment disorders at a lower cost (Baumann, Donker, and Ophuis, 2017). However these studies have mostly limited their economic analyses to a societal perspective and failed to distinguish between system-level and patient-side costs. This lack of knowledge hinders the ability of policymakers to make informed decisions about the effectiveness of digital mental health interventions.

Although many online mental health assessments can be helpful but users must be cautious when taking them. Some tests that seem fun may be clever ruses to gather personal information, such as passwords. These data can be sold to marketers, or used to determine passwords. It is crucial to use reputable sites and review their privacy policies.
